About Callum.
Callum Durrant is an Actor raised in Surrey, England and is currently located in Farnham. In 2024, he graduated from the University for the Creative Arts with a BA (Hons) in Acting and Performance.
​
Callum discovered his passion for acting during childhood; he found that it allowed him to become someone else, creating a chance to experience a lifestyle different to his own.
​
As he explored acting and performance, Callum learnt that it was more than simply escaping reality. From the teachings of practitioners like Uta Hagen and Sanford Meisner, he realized that the truth of acting focuses on the narrative, leading the audience to believe in the story, rather than showcasing individual skill. Over time, Callum developed the ability to connect with audiences, even when it seemed like an audience couldn't relate to a character.
​
Currently pursuing an MA in Acting for Screen at the University for the Creative Arts, Callum continues to explore his own creativity in writing. Samples of his work can be found on his social media platforms:
